## Session handling: Fleet fuel-usage report

The Marrowbrook fuel-usage report runs under a dedicated service session that expires after 45 minutes, so the release manager should schedule export jobs well inside that window. Sessions are renewed automatically only if a request lands in the final five minutes; otherwise the job must re-authenticate, which invalidates cached pagination cursors. For the upcoming release verification run, authenticate the report job with the bearer token below.

session JWT of yawep-yawep = eyJhbGciOiJIUzI1NiIsInR5cCI6IkpXVCJ9.eyJzdWIiOiI3pWF3_In0.aXYsHiog

# Build Provenance: HueCheck Contrast Audit

Quick note for whoever inherits this: the HueCheck audit bundle is built nightly from the palette repo, and every bundle bakes in the exact ruleset version used. If results look off, first confirm you're on a canonical build. You can verify against the token recorded below.

build token for tawip-yageg: htk9_92ac43d42

## MatchPoint 5.2 — Key Rotation

Heads up, plugin folks: we finally tamed the GC pauses in the matching service (switched to the Larkspur collector, p99 pause is now under 12ms). While we were in there, we rotated the plugin-signing credentials, so grab the fresh one. Verify your builds against the key below.

deploy key for kajof-fajop: bky6_gDHw9Q